You need to have a clear idea of where your strengths lie to succeed in business, and then think of a product or a service you can offer that uses your expertise, that you are passionate about, and you believe you can make a success of.

Take the time to think through clearly before starting on your own and try to do it for positive reasons rather than negative ones.

To add to the above I would say research, research, research. Who are your comepetetors? How do they run their businesses. How do they differ from each other, how are they the same, what could you do differently, what could you improve on.......
